Output 0e95efa1bc31323033dc198a1089eb6d21b9d9decc35f73fa566d243eedab371:0

value
870000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65161868bbab2d48e964d4189810bacf252758fc OP_EQUALVERIFY OP_CHECKSIG
address
DEMbFqxsd5LzeHSWorEWN4fxhzGHLBGC3z
transaction
0e95efa1bc31323033dc198a1089eb6d21b9d9decc35f73fa566d243eedab371